About

Xin Fan is a scholar working on Electrical and Electronic Engineering, Computer Networks and Communications and Artificial Intelligence. According to data from OpenAlex, Xin Fan has authored 24 papers receiving a total of 241 indexed citations (citations by other indexed papers that have themselves been cited), including 18 papers in Electrical and Electronic Engineering, 16 papers in Computer Networks and Communications and 8 papers in Artificial Intelligence. Recurrent topics in Xin Fan’s work include Wireless Communication Security Techniques (11 papers), Cooperative Communication and Network Coding (8 papers) and Privacy-Preserving Technologies in Data (6 papers). Xin Fan is often cited by papers focused on Wireless Communication Security Techniques (11 papers), Cooperative Communication and Network Coding (8 papers) and Privacy-Preserving Technologies in Data (6 papers). Xin Fan collaborates with scholars based in China, United States and Australia. Xin Fan's co-authors include Yan Huo, Zhi Tian, Yue Wang, Xiuzhen Cheng, Liran Ma, Dechang Chen, Tao Jing, Chenlu Li, Liang Huang and Chunqiang Hu and has published in prestigious journals such as IEEE Access, IEEE Transactions on Wireless Communications and IEEE Transactions on Intelligent Transportation Systems.
